Jobs for Radiation Protection/Health Physics Technician Grads in Georgia

380 people in the state and 25,250 in the nation are employed in jobs related to radiation protection/health physics technician.

Wages for Radiation Protection/Health Physics Technician Jobs in Georgia

In this state, radiation protection/health physics technician grads earn an average of $63,570. Nationwide, they make an average of $55,270.
